在过去的三天里,一群 Mozilla 开发者齐聚辛辛那提,品尝 N-way 辣酱(以及其他奶酪美食),并改进 MDN 文档中心。这次聚会规模是 去年 10 月首次线下文档冲刺 的两倍。这次冲刺紧随 开放帮助会议 之后,并与 Gnome 文档 团队的成员分享了时间、空间、食物和乐趣,他们也在进行冲刺。
以下是此次冲刺成果的(几乎肯定不完整)列表
- David Bruant 完成了关于 JavaScript
this
和 WeakMap 的页面,并改进了其他一些关于全局对象的文章。 - 来自 包容性设计研究中心 的 Anastasia Cheetham 和 Colin Clark 继续更新和迁移来自 CodeTalks.org 的可访问性内容。Anastasia 创建了关于 可访问的动态内容 和 可访问的表单 的文章,而 Colin 开始了一个关于 Web 应用和 ARIA 的常见问题解答。在冲刺期间,Colin 还向小组展示了 NVDA 开源屏幕阅读器 的演示,演示了访问 MDN 首页和 GitHub 的过程。我很高兴 MDN 表现得不错,但 Colin 也为开发团队提供了一些反馈。
- Trevor Hobson 为 Firefox 开发者版页面添加了界面更改,添加了许多新的界面页面,并改进了一些内联模板。
- 来自 Google 的 Kevin Lim 清理或更新了许多 CSS、HTML 和 JavaScript 页面。
- Daniel Lopretto 审查并改进了许多 JavaScript 指南 部分和 document.cookie 文章,并添加了一个关于 如何创建自定义错误类型 的示例。
- Ms2ger(远程参与!)编辑了 David Bruant 今年早些时候撰写的 JavaScript 技术概述。
- Jeremie Patonnier(远程参与!)为 SVG Rect、Circle、Line、Polyline 和 Polygon 添加了 DOM 参考文章,并清理了 DOM 参考页面 和其他页面。
- Florian Scholz 审查了所有 HTML 元素 页面,以确保它们具有一致的兼容性表格,重构了 CSS 参考页面,并创建了一个用于归属来自 MDN 外部来源的内容的模板。
- Tom Schuster 为所有重要的方法和属性添加了 JavaScript 版本和 ECMAScript 版本,从 Kangax 迁移了兼容性信息,并更新了许多代码示例。
- Christian Sonne 编写了一个模板,将多个页面中的兼容性数据聚合到一个大型表格中(例如,针对所有 HTML 元素)。一旦错误被排除,我们将开始在几个领域使用它。他还撰写了一篇关于 animation-fill-mode 的文章并更新了几个相关的页面,提高了许多模板和兼容性表格的一致性,并为 <progress> 元素编写了一个实时示例。
- Manuel Strehl 校对 SVG 教程,添加了一个关于 SVG 字体 的教程部分,并为 font、font-* 和 filters 添加了 SVG 元素 文章。
- Janet Swisher 更新或澄清了几个元项目页面,例如 格式指南 和 编写指南;编辑并添加了 CSS 教程的 JavaScript 主题 的解决方案。
非常感谢所有冲刺参与者付出的时间和辛勤工作,也感谢 Shaun McCance 组织开放帮助会议以及冲刺的当地安排。
2 条评论